Exploring the Ghost Town of Madrid

Once visitors arrive at the designated meeting point, they’ll be greeted by the historic charm of Madrid, a former coal mining town that has been transformed into a captivating ghost town.

The self-guided audio tour leads them through the town’s abandoned buildings, sharing the stories of its past. Visitors can explore the Opera House, the Old Boarding House, and the Gypsy Gem at their own pace, learning about the town’s history and character.

The GPS-guided tour ensures they won’t get lost, allowing them to enjoy the eerie atmosphere of this unique New Mexico destination.
